Ansel Adams

    Ansel Adams was born in San Francisco, CA in February 20th 1902. Ansel Adams was a smart but shy kid at a young age. Unfortunately, through out his school years he had problems fitting in due to that he was a smart and shy kid. Also because he had a broken nose ever since he was four years old. At the age of 12 he began to play the piano and taught himself how to read music. Soon enough it became his occupation until he was 22 years old. But then soon after left music, to do his passion, which was photography. It was not until 1927 that his first photograph was fully visualized. It was a photograph of monolith, the face of half dome. After seeing the success of this photograph, it gave him the inspiration to peruse his dreams. 

Three interesting facts of Adams are:
  • That Adams had a passion to photograph the wilderness and the environment.
  • He described himself as a photographer, lecturer, and a writer.
  • Adams vast achieve of papers, memorabilia, correspondence, negative and many fine photographic prints are now at the center of creative photographs at the University of Arizona, Tucson.
